AI Summary

The University of Connecticut (UConn) is a large, well-established public research university with multiple campuses across Connecticut. The website reflects a professional and comprehensive digital presence, showcasing academic programs, research initiatives, campus life, and community engagement. The site targets prospective and current students, faculty, alumni, and the general public interested in higher education and research. The university maintains a strong market position as a leading educational institution in the region. Technically, the website is built on WordPress with modern technologies including Google Analytics, Microsoft Clarity, and Google Tag Manager for analytics and tracking. The site is well-optimized for performance, mobile responsiveness, and accessibility, with good SEO practices and structured data implementation. Hosting appears to leverage Microsoft Azure services, indicating a robust infrastructure. From a security perspective, the site enforces HTTPS and uses standard security best practices, including cookie consent mechanisms and privacy policies compliant with GDPR. While explicit security headers are not fully visible in the HTML, the overall posture is strong with no evident vulnerabilities or exposed sensitive data. The WHOIS data confirms domain legitimacy and consistency with the university's identity. Overall, the website presents a low-risk profile with strong business credibility, good privacy compliance, and a secure technical foundation. Strategic recommendations include enhancing explicit security headers, publishing a dedicated security policy, and ongoing monitoring of third-party scripts to maintain security and compliance.

Security Posture Analysis

Comprehensive Security Assessment

The website demonstrates a mature security posture with HTTPS enforced and privacy compliance mechanisms in place. No critical vulnerabilities or exposed sensitive data were detected. The use of cookie consent banners and privacy policies indicates awareness of regulatory requirements. However, explicit security headers like X-Frame-Options and X-Content-Type-Options are not visible in the HTML and should be verified server-side. Incident response and security policy pages are not found, suggesting room for improvement in transparency and readiness. Overall, the security culture appears positive but could benefit from enhanced documentation and header implementation.
